Transaction 51b371b6ff7c358ee8e8fcc11224a4da93e6b4a17e7ef235a1abd6bc23902804

1 Input
2 Outputs
  • 51b371b6ff7c358ee8e8fcc11224a4da93e6b4a17e7ef235a1abd6bc23902804:0
  • value  21292
    address  3HKT75ADheqDsaBVXzdduuJB8Spy8HRJ3M
  • 51b371b6ff7c358ee8e8fcc11224a4da93e6b4a17e7ef235a1abd6bc23902804:1
  • value  19801
    address  bc1qeu4snd7edu09k6l37xdgs2ss6t6usa3whtd9uh